Tze-Ho Chen is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, Tze-Ho Chen has authored 18 papers receiving a total of 274 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Molecular Biology, 5 papers in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health and 5 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in Tze-Ho Chen's work include Cancer-related Molecular Pathways (3 papers), Maternal and fetal healthcare (2 papers) and Pregnancy and preeclampsia studies (2 papers). Tze-Ho Chen is often cited by papers focused on Cancer-related Molecular Pathways (3 papers), Maternal and fetal healthcare (2 papers) and Pregnancy and preeclampsia studies (2 papers). Tze-Ho Chen collaborates with scholars based in Taiwan, Switzerland and United States. Tze-Ho Chen's co-authors include Shun‐Fa Yang, Yahui Chen, Yi‐Hsuan Hsiao, Horng‐Der Tsai, Ming Chen, Ming‐Chih Chou, Shou‐Jen Kuo, Gwo‐Chin Ma, Kun‐Tu Yeh and Jin‐Chung Shih and has published in prestigious journals such as Cancers, Antioxidants and Journal of Clinical Medicine.
